Pueblo Community College to buy Pueblo West building for trade programs

Pueblo Community College

PUEBLO WEST, Colo. (KRDO) -- Pueblo Community College (PCC) says it has plans to purchase a building in Pueblo West to expand some of its trade programs.

PCC says it has entered an agreement for a building at 713 E. Spaulding Ave. It would expand the automotive and welding programs which are currently taught in several places across Pueblo, but often have waiting lists to meet the demand, according to officials.

The classes are currently taught at the Orman Avenue campus in Pueblo, its southwest campus in Mancos, Pueblo West High School and CaƱon City High School. PCC's president says the plan is to grow the school and help the programs grow as well.

Officials say the business plan for the new property would contribute revenue back to the overall budget for the college. It is expected to cost around $3 million.

The school says funding has come from reserves the college has collected over several years, as well as $1 million that was raised in a campaign by the PCC Foundation for the purchase and operations of the building.

PCC says it expects its new location to open in the fall of 2027.
